Watch: Australian Open crowd loudly boos Iga Swiatek over Melbourne espresso remark

Watch: Australian Open crowd loudly boos Iga Swiatek over Melbourne espresso remark
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email Tumblr Reddit Telegram WhatsApp Copy Link

Iga Swiatek made a remark that she most likely regrets now because the Australian Open crowd handled her with loud boos after she acknowledged that Sydney has higher espresso outlets than Melbourne. 

Off the court docket, the Polish tennis star likes to loosen up by ingesting some espresso and studying books. 

In the meantime, Melbourne’s espresso spots are broadly thought to be top-of-the-line on this planet. 

So after Swiatek demolished Rebecca Sramkova 6-0 6-2 within the Australian Open second spherical, on-court interviewer Jelena Dokic requested the Pole to charge Melbourne’s espresso. 

“How does the coffee in Melbourne compare to the rest of the world?” Dokic requested.

“Well I got to say in Sydney I found better coffee shops,” the 23-year-old stated whereas laughing.

Iga Swiatek© Australian Open/X – Truthful Use

 

And that is when the gang immediately reacted. 

The five-time Grand Slam winner tried to backtrack on her assertion.

“No guys, the thing is, it’s not easy to fall asleep during a grand slam so my coffee needs to be lower, so I didn’t do the right research… Sorry for my answer,” she stated.

— #AusOpen (@AustralianOpen) January 16, 2025 Swiatek thrilled together with her play on Thursday

The No. 2 seed made a lightning begin to her second-round match, profitable the opening seven video games for a dominant 6-0 1-0 lead.

Whereas Sramkova managed to stabilize a bit from that second and have the second set tied to 2 video games apiece, the Pole remained unfazed and claimed the next 4 video games to finish her victory in an hour of play.

“I felt really solid today, it was a really efficient game,” Swiatek stated.

In her subsequent match, the previous world No. 1 performs towards Emma Raducanu. 

Going into the match, Swiatek has a 3-0 head-to-head document and has but to lose a set in matches towards the 2021 US Open champion.
